I hereby submit, for your consideration and approval, the following citizen committee appointments.  Committee applications for mayoral appointments are attached.  Statement of Interest forms are on file for these appointees where applicable.
 
 
BOARD OF HEALTH FOR MADISON AND DANE COUNTY
 
MARK E. EDGAR (15th A.D.) - appoint to the remainder of a three-year term to the position of City Resident.  Mr. Edgar is the coordinator for the Wisconsin Center for Public Health Education and Training.  He succeeds Susan J. Zahner.
TERM EXPIRES: 4-15-2014
 
 
COMMITTEE ON AGING
 
FAISAL A. KAUD (18th A.D.) - appoint to the remainder of a three-year term to the position of Member (55+ Years of Age).  Mr. Kaud is retired from the University of Wisconsin Hospitals and Clinics.  He has served on numerous board and is currently a member of the Finance Committee for the Community Action Coalition for South Central Wisconsin.  Mr. Kaud succeeds Timothy D. Otis.
TERM EXPIRES: 10-1-2015
 
ROSEMARY LEE (4th A.D.) - appoint to the remainder of a three-year term to the position of Member.  Ms. Lee has served on several Capitol Neighborhood, Inc. committees as well as city committees, most recently the Vending Oversight Committee and the Downtown Coordinating Committee.
TERM EXPIRES: 10-1-2014
 
 
PUBLIC SAFETY REVIEW COMMITTEE
 
MATTHEW S. MACWILLIAMS (16th A.D.) - appoint to the remainder of a three-year term to the position of Citizen Member.  Mr. MacWilliams is an attorney with his own firm.  He succeeds Ryan M. Jennissen.
TERM EXPIRES: 4-30-2015
